Archaeology Behind the Scenes Tours

Thomas Jefferson's Poplar Forest 687 Poplar Forest Dr., Forest, VA, United States

An amateur archaeologist himself, Thomas Jefferson would surely be fascinated by the more than 300,000 artifacts found on the Poplar Forest grounds since 1986. Dinnertime in World War II Virtual Event

National D-Day Memorial 3 Overlord Circle, Bedford, VA, United States

Have you wondered what meals were like during World War II both on the warfront and at home with rationing? Using recipes and ration kits from the National D-Day Memorial's archives, join the Education Department staff as they discuss cooking during the 1940s and even taste test recipes and rations.
